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
555596 2488485278 1677670 476
383 6338687 83
383 6338687 83
997586030 11770 322447 23
All about undefined
Interested in learning more?
383 6338687 83
997586030 11770 322447 23
See more
078 12941562 260
522939 38 2860568979 81092
See more
8048 672 67
8550929676 3344 75
See more